DescriptionDisulfur-elpot-transparent-3D-balls.png | A van der Waals' surface coloured according to charge, superimposed on a ball-and-stick model of the disulfur molecule, S2. Red represents partially negatively charged regions, blue represents partially positively charged regions, and white represents neutral (uncharged) regions. | |||
